peachananr / onepage-scroll

Create an Apple-like one page scroller website (iPhone 5S website) with One Page Scroll plugin
http://peachananr.github.io/onepage-scroll/Demo/demo.html
9.55k stars 2.07k forks source link

How work with grid system? #315

Open lexa45ru opened 7 years ago

lexa45ru commented 7 years ago

Hello freinds. Please help me in my trouble. I have sceleton page like this: section id="g-mainbody" div class="g-grid" div id="slide-about" class="g-block nopaddingall nomarginall slide slide-about size-100" div class="g-content" div class="moduletable" div class="g-particle" h2Title 1/h2 h3Subtitle 1/h3 divSome text 1/div /div /div /div /div /div div class="g-grid" div id="slide-next" class="g-block nopaddingall nomarginall slide slide-about size-100" div class="g-content" div class="moduletable" div class="g-particle" h2Title 2/h2 divSome text 2/div /div /div /div /div /div `/section``

This sceleton generated over gravCMS with Gantry5 framework

I execute script with this parametr sectionContainer: ".g-grid .slide" or sectionContainer: "div.g-grid div.slide" no difference.

On output i see both slides on page and working navigation

Sorry for my english

MSupreme1990 commented 7 years ago

го на русском!!!

lexa45ru commented 7 years ago

Проблема в общем такая есть скелет, тот что выше, для примера там два блока, но на самом деле их будет больше. Блоки добавляются из админки (CMS Grav, шаблон Gantry5 Helium). Так вот каждый блок посредством шаблона обрамляется еще одним блоком g-grid, и как мне кажется из-за этого скрипт неправильно обрабатывает эти блоки. На выходе я получаю оба блока на одном экране, Навигация работает, параметры блоков slide меняются при скролле, но они на одном экране и не активный не скрывается.

UPD: сейчас убрал блоки g-grid из скелета, ничего не поменялось. Завтра буду копаться с CSSками

MSupreme1990 commented 7 years ago

Я думаю, что у тебя просто не правильно настроен сам скрипт. Посмотри настройки скрипта и почитай документацию, обрати внимание на вложенность, всё ли правильно, я думаю что-то из этого должно помочь)

lexa45ru commented 7 years ago

Сам скрипт работает, и это видно, потому что меняются параметры блоков, меняется положение навигатора страничного, но сами страницы не меняются. UPD: все дело было, как я и подразумевал, в CSS.